Dolly de Leon’s Agnes’ first psychedelic experience on Nine Perfect Strangers pulls back the curtain on her nun days and ends with a trip to jail.
Warning: Spoilers below from Nine Perfect Strangers season 2, episode 3.
During the Wednesday, May 28, episode, Martin (Lucas Englander) takes eight of the nine retreaters on a “field trip” into town to officially start Masha’s (Nicole Kidman) protocol. While Masha stays behind and tests illusive ninth guest David (Mark Strong), Martin gives the rest of the group their first dose of psychedelic tea.
Most of the group experiences fun hallucinations; Peter (Henry Golding) and Imogen (Annie Murphy) dance around as fictional Swiss characters Peter and Heidi, but Agnes (de Leon) goes deep.
The former nun hears church bells and flashes back to a traumatic experience where she was also a nurse. Agnes follows the bells to a nearby house of worship and reveals that her “guilt” stems from not saving a pregnant woman and her child.
According to the flashback, Agnes told her mother superior that something was wrong with the pregnancy, but the head nun instructed her to “pray for her soul” and let God’s will be done. Agnes blames herself for their deaths and during her trip seeks forgiveness from God but receives no answer.
A distraught Agnes is later found in a confessional booth smashing her head into the wood which leads to her arrest. “No one was there. No priest. No God. Just me. I was talking to myself,” she tells Martin when he comes to bail her out.
Martin apologizes for not being there to protect her during the trip, blaming Masha for leaving him on his own, but Agnes isn’t upset. “I am responsible for what happened to me,” Agnes says.
Once the group is back at the retreat, Agnes seems to be back on solid ground. She decides to sleep in her bed — and not on the floor, which she usually does as a form of discomfort and punishment for her sins. After looking at herself and her scars in the mirror, she finally settles into a deep sleep.
The rest of the group also settles in for the night, but Imogen and Peter’s hookup is interrupted by his father, David. Masha purposely put him in Peter’s room as a “joke” after he passed out during their cold plunge earlier that afternoon. (Masha and David spent the day together since he was late for breakfast and missed the day trip.)
After the awkward exchange, Masha calls David asking why he was “rattled” seeing his son, which he claims isn’t the case. As Masha starts to peel back the layers of David’s father-son dynamic she drops their call.
David then notices Masha is watching him from a camera at the bar and flips her off. “Oh, well, f*** you too,” she says with a smirk before sipping her own psychedelic tea.
